A Rich History: Tracing the Evolution of Slot Machines

The origins of slot machines can be traced back to the late 19th century. In 1891, Charles Fey introduced the "Liberty Bell," widely regarded as the first modern slot machine. This iconic device featured spinning reels with fruit symbols and a simple payout mechanism.

Over the years, slot machines evolved, incorporating innovations from both mechanical and electronic advancements. In the 1960s, electromechanical slot machines emerged, featuring blinking lights and sound effects, revolutionizing the gaming experience.

The late 1970s marked the introduction of video slots, which introduced computer-generated graphics and interactive gameplay, paving the way for the modern slot machines we know today.

Identifying Valuable Antique Slot Machines

Determining the value of an antique slot machine can be a complex endeavor. Several factors influence its worth, including:

  • Age: Older slot machines, especially pre-World War II models, tend to be more valuable.
  • Rarity: Limited-edition or rare slot machines command higher prices.
  • Condition: Well-preserved and fully functional machines fetch higher prices.
  • Manufacturer: Slot machines from reputable manufacturers, such as Mills Novelty Company, Bally Manufacturing Corporation, and Wurlitzer, are generally more valuable.
  • Historical Significance: Slot machines associated with historical events or famous individuals can have significant value.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overpaying: Thoroughly research market values before making a purchase.
  • Buying Reproductions: Beware of counterfeit or reproduction slot machines that lack historical value.
  • Ignoring Condition: Ensure that the slot machine is in good working order and has been properly maintained.
  • Neglecting Restoration: If necessary, seek professional restoration services to preserve the integrity and value of your antique slot machine.
